Output e52a00ed2ec64081360b36166136a7ddfb005e548583a377fd8df76d9cb0ba2e:0

value
2830060
script pubkey
OP_0 OP_PUSHBYTES_20 26a393f2ab28c0bcc5eb78a769313b75282e8f8e
address
bc1qy63e8u4t9rqte30t0znkjvfmw55zaruwvzyhsc
transaction
e52a00ed2ec64081360b36166136a7ddfb005e548583a377fd8df76d9cb0ba2e
confirmations
158818
spent
true